What is a Func Spec? If a client’s website was a building, then the Functional Specification would be the blueprint. It is a document that, in its most basic form, specifies the functions that a system must perform. This concept is bilateral, pertaining to both end users and business users or content managers.

What is included in a functional design specification?

– A Functional Design Specification can have many types of layouts but will typically contain a basic overview of each main part of the system, its function and how it will operate.

How do you write a good functional specification?

Here’s a list of what goes into making good specifications:

  1. Product managers should ensure that all requirements are captured and all business rules are accurate.
  2. Designers should define the user interface and interactions.
  3. QA should be able to find enough information in the document to reflect the changes in tests.

How do you write a functional requirement?

Well-written functional requirements typically have the following characteristics:

  1. Necessary. Although functional requirements may have different priority, every one of them needs to relate to a particular business goal or user requirement.
  2. Concise.
  3. Attainable.
  4. Granular.
  5. Consistent.
  6. Verifiable.

What are the functional specifications for web design?

The Functional Specifications for Web Design. Functional specifications are like blueprints for implementing your business’ website. As a first crucial step in Web design, functional specs are mostly focused on the user experience and include elements like use-case scenarios, mock-ups, wire-frames for navigation and a general written description.
